Located in scenic Page, Arizona, Antelope Point Marina & RV Park offers a premier gateway to exploring the stunning waters of Lake Powell. Known for its striking red rock formations and crystal-clear water, Lake Powell is a unique recreational hotspot in the southwestern United States. Antelope Point Marina serves as a hub for private boat rentals, jet ski excursions, and comfortable RV camping, providing visitors a chance to experience the lake’s extraordinary natural beauty firsthand. The marina’s proximity to iconic sites like Antelope Canyon—fed by the Colorado River—makes it an attractive base for adventurers seeking waterborne exploration combined with dramatic desert landscapes. The park itself is thoughtfully maintained and includes amenities such as electric hookups, potable water, restrooms, and a welcoming grill area, ensuring convenience during your stay.

Key features include the vast Lake Powell reservoir framed by striking Navajo sandstone cliffs, slot canyons famed for their light beams, and the nearby unique floating restaurant experience, noted as the second largest in the world. Visitors appreciate the blend of water sports opportunities: from jet skiing on open waters to leisurely pontoon boat cruises that offer perspectives on the lake’s unspoiled coves and cliffs. While the marina’s shuttle system can be somewhat challenging due to the lake’s fluctuating water levels, the overall experience captivates those eager to reconnect with nature and explore one of Arizona’s most magnificent outdoor locations.

Adventure Tips

Arrive Early for Boat Rentals

Boat rentals can be busy; get there early to avoid long lines and ensure you secure the vessel you want.

Bring Your Own Life Jacket

While life jackets are provided, bringing your own ensures a better fit and added comfort on the water.

Prepare for Windy Conditions

Lake Powell can get windy, especially in open areas; dress in layers and secure loose items on your boat or jetski.

Use Shuttle Services Strategically

Shuttle carts connect parking lots to the marina; confirm shuttle times and locations in advance to save wait time.

History

Lake Powell was formed after the Glen Canyon Dam construction in 1963, flooding Navajo sandstone canyons and creating this vast reservoir.

Conservation

Efforts to maintain Lake Powell focus on water level management and minimizing pollution to protect local aquatic ecosystems.
